Comments:
A monitoring/renewal/complaint inspection was conducted on 4/21/2022. There were 18 children present, ranging in ages from 2 yrs to 5 yrs, with 3 staff supervising. The inspector reviewed compliance in the areas of administration, physical plant, staffing and supervision, programming, medication, special care and emergencies and nutrition. A total of 3 child records and 3 staff records were reviewed.

Information gathered during the inspection determined non-compliance with applicable standards or law and violations were documented on the violation notice issued to the program.

Violations:
Standard #: 8VAC20-780-245-H
Description: Based upon review of staff records, the facility has not ensured that annual training of staff includes the prevention of and response to emergencies due to food and other allergic reactions.
Evidence:
The record for staff 3 did not include documentation of any annual training regarding the prevention of emergencies due to allergies. Staff 2 had an open can of cashew nuts on the staff desk in the school age classroom when the facility has a nut free p[olicy due to a child's allergy.

Plan of Correction: The facility responded with the following:
Appropriate action will be taken with the staff person to ensure detailed training addressing the facilities policies regarding prevention of children's allergies and the nut free status of the facility.

Standard #: 8VAC20-780-450-B
Description: Based upon observation and staff interview, the facility has not ensured that linens are assigned for individual use.
Evidence:
1. The blankets to be used by the children during naptime were observed to be piled once atop another on a low table in the toddler classroom allowing for potential cross contamination.
2. Staff 2 acknowledged that the blankets were piled one atop another in the toddler classroom prior to lunch time.

Plan of Correction: The facility responded with the following:
Staff were immediately instructed to remove the blankets and place in each's child's cubby. All staff will be reminded of the importance of keeping children's individual articles separate to avoid cross contamination.

Standard #: 8VAC20-780-510-E
Description: Based upon review of children's medication and staff interview, the facility has not followed their procedures for ensuring the physician's prescriptions are followed.
Evidence:
1.There is an albuterol inhaler for child 4. The prescription label indicated that the medication was to be discarded after December 2021.
2. Staff 2 verified that the prescription label indicated that the medication was to have been discarded after December 2021.

Plan of Correction: The facility responded with the following:
The albuterol medication did not expire until April 2022. Staff did not see the conflicting instructions on the prescription label. All staff certified to administer medication will be trained to read all instruction on prescriptions very carefully and review any questions with the parent/physician.

Standard #: 8VAC20-780-580-B
Description: Based upon observation and interview, the facility has not ensured that any vehicle used for the transportation of children he vehicle meets the safety standards set by the Department of Motor Vehicles.
Evidence:
1. Staff 2 verified that the gold colored van is the vehicle currently being used to transport school aged children from school. The state inspection sticker expired in March 2022.
2. Staff 1 verified that the inspection sticker expired in March 2022.

Plan of Correction: The facility responded with the following:
The van was immediately scheduled for an inspection. Proof of passing inspection was submitted to the inspector on 04/22, 2022.
